Loyall, Kentucky
Feb 2004
Loyall, Kentucky Loyall, a small Harlan county town, grew up around a railroad switch yard -- opened in 1922 as Shonn, a local word for a rail siding, and was renamed Loyall in 1932, perhaps for a railroad company official. The population in --
